{bc}

Software Engineer - Security (m/f/d)

Halian | Managed Services, Recruitment Agency & Contract StaffingAbu Dhabi Emirate, UAEYesterdayMid-Senior
Mid-Seniorfulltime

Role Purpose The Software Engineer is responsible for ensuring the secure and timely deployment of patches and updates across mission-critical banking platforms.

Skills

JavaPythonC++

About This Role

Role Purpose

The Software Engineer is responsible for ensuring the

secure and timely deployment of patches and updates

across mission-critical banking platforms.

The role focuses on

automating regression testing

, remediating application and API vulnerabilities, and embedding

security validation into CI/CD pipelines

to enable safe and stable releases.

This position plays a key role in maintaining

application security, system stability, and compliance

, while supporting continuous delivery in a fast-paced banking environment.

• Secure Patch Deployment & Release Management

  • Plan and execute timely deployment of security patches across:
  • + Core banking platforms
  • + Corporate banking systems
  • + Consumer and digital banking applications
  • Ensure minimal disruption and high system stability during releases
  • Prepare and maintain:
  • + Release notes
  • + Impact assessments
  • + Rollback plans

• Automated Regression Testing

  • Develop and maintain automated regression test suites for critical applications
  • Validate patches and updates prior to release to ensure:
  • + No functional regressions
  • + System performance stability
  • Integrate automated testing into CI/CD pipelines

• Vulnerability Remediation & Secure Coding

  • Identify and remediate vulnerabilities aligned with:

+ OWASP API Security Top 10

  • Fix security defects identified through:
  • + SAST / DAST / SCA tools
  • + Internal and external security assessments
  • Collaborate with development teams to enforce secure coding standards

• CI/CD Integration & DevSecOps Practices

  • Integrate security validation checks into CI/CD pipelines:
  • + Automated patch validation
  • + Security testing gates
  • Work closely with DevOps teams to ensure:
  • + Seamless build and deployment processes
  • + Secure release pipelines
  • Support implementation of DevSecOps best practices

• Collaboration & Cross-Functional Support

  • Work with:
  • + Application development teams
  • + DevOps / infrastructure teams
  • + Cybersecurity teams
  • Provide technical support for:
  • + Patch-related issues
  • + Production incidents related to releases
  • Ensure alignment between development, testing, and security functions

• Compliance & Documentation

  • Ensure all releases comply with:
  • + Internal security policies
  • + Banking regulatory requirements
  • Maintain documentation for:
  • + Patch deployments
  • + Test results
  • + Security validations
  • Support audit and compliance reviews

Education

  • Bachelor’s degree in:
  • + Computer Science
  • + Software Engineering
  • + Information Technology or related field

Experience

  • 5–8 years of experience in:
  • + Software engineering or application support
  • + Release management and patch deployment
  • Experience working with:
  • + Enterprise-scale applications
  • + Banking or regulated environments (preferred)

Technical Skills

  • Strong knowledge of:
  • + Software development lifecycle (SDLC)
  • + CI/CD tools (e.g., Jenkins, GitHub Actions, Azure DevOps)
  • Experience with:
  • + Automated testing frameworks
  • + API development and security practices
  • Familiarity with:
  • + Security testing tools (SAST, DAST, SCA)
  • + OWASP Top 10 & API Security Top 10
  • Proficiency in:
  • + Programming/scripting (Java, Python, or similar)

Soft Skills

  • Strong problem-solving and debugging skills
  • Attention to detail and quality focus
  • Ability to work in high-pressure, production-critical environments
  • Effective communication and teamwork

• Automated Testing & Quality Assurance

  • DevSecOps Practices
  • Vulnerability Remediation

Ideal Candidate Profile

  • Engineer with strong experience in application maintenance and secure releases
  • Hands-on in automated testing and CI/CD integration
  • Familiar with security best practices and vulnerability remediation
  • Experience working on enterprise banking platforms or mission-critical systems
  • Ability to balance speed of delivery with system stability and security
  • Software Engineer - Security in Abu Dhabi, United Arab Emirates

Your resume, rewritten for this exact role.

Sign up free — Base Career tailors your CV to this job description in 60 seconds.

01 / 05

Resume Tailored to This Job

Resume Tailored to This Job

Your keywords, structure, and story — rewritten to match this exact role and pass ATS filters.

Get My Tailored Resume

Free · No card · 60 seconds

02 / 05

Cover Letter for This Role, Done

Cover Letter for This Role, Done

Job-specific cover letters written in Gulf professional tone — ready in seconds, not hours.

Get My Cover Letter

Free · No card · 60 seconds

03 / 05

See How Well You Fit This Role

See How Well You Fit This Role

AI match score with clear reasons — know your fit before investing time in the application.

Check My Fit Score

Free · No card · 60 seconds

04 / 05

Use Autofill When You Apply

Use Autofill When You Apply

Autofill any application form on Workday, LinkedIn, Bayt, Greenhouse — with your tailored content.

Tailor Resume First

Free · No card · 60 seconds

05 / 05

Track It. Follow Up at the Right Time.

Track It. Follow Up at the Right Time.

Visual pipeline for every application with AI-timed follow-up reminders so nothing slips.

Track My Applications

Free · No card · 60 seconds

Similar Jobs

Go Software Engineer (Remote)

Hire Feed · Abu Dhabi

Mid-Seniorcontract

Role: Golang Developer Location: Remote (Work from Anywhere) * Payout: $30–$80/hour Role Overview: We are hiring for one of our clients, seeking a Golang Developer to work on a contract basis. This role involves designi

Skills

JavaPythonC++

Backend Software Engineer (Remote)

Hire Feed · Abu Dhabi

contract

Role: Backend Software Engineer (Remote) Location: Remote (Work from Anywhere) * Payout: $60-$110/hour Role Overview: We are hiring for one of our clients, seeking a Backend Engineer to work on a contract basis. This ro

Skills

JavaPythonC++

Backend Software Engineer (Remote)

Hire Feed · Dubai

Entryparttime

Role : Backend Software Engineer (Remote) Location : Remote (Work from Anywhere) * Payout : $20 - $70/hour Role Overview: Join one of our clients, a global leader in the technology industry, as a Backend Engineer for a

Skills

JavaPythonC++

Senior Software Engineer (Remote)

Hire Feed · Dubai

Entryparttime

Role : Senior Software Engineer (Remote) Location : Remote (Work from Anywhere) * Payout : $30 - $130/hour Role Overview: As a Sr Software Engineer, you will collaborate with a dynamic team to design, develop, and maint

Skills

Software ArchitectureSystem DesignAgile Methodologies

Senior Software Engineer (Remote)

Hire Feed · Abu Dhabi

Entryparttime

Role : Senior Software Engineer (Remote) Location : Remote (Work from Anywhere) * Payout : $30 - $130/hour Role Overview: As a Sr Software Engineer, you will collaborate with a dynamic team to design, develop, and maint

Skills

Software ArchitectureSystem DesignAgile Methodologies

Backend Software Engineer (Remote)

Hire Feed · Abu Dhabi

Entryparttime

Role : Backend Software Engineer (Remote) Location : Remote (Work from Anywhere) * Payout : $20 - $70/hour Role Overview: Join one of our clients, a global leader in the technology industry, as a Backend Engineer for a

Skills

JavaPythonC++

Senior Full Stack Software Engineer (Remote)

Hire Feed · Abu Dhabi

Entryparttime

Role : Senior Full Stack Software Engineer (Remote) Location : Remote (Work from Anywhere) * Payout : $20 - $55/hour Role Overview: One of our clients, a global leader in the technology industry, is seeking a skilled Se

Skills

JavaPythonC++

Full Stack Software Engineer (Remote)

Hired · Abu Dhabi

contract

Role : Full Stack Software Engineer (Remote) Location : Remote (Work from Anywhere) * Payout : Competitive Role Overview: We are hiring for one of our clients, seeking a Senior Software Engineer – C#(LLM Evaluation & Re

Skills

JavaPythonC++

Senior Software Engineer (Remote)

Hired · Abu Dhabi

Seniorcontract

Role : Senior Software Engineer (Remote) Location : Remote (Work from Anywhere) * Payout : Competitive Role Overview: We are hiring for one of our clients, seeking a Senior Software Engineer – C++ (LLM Evaluation & Repo

Skills

Software ArchitectureSystem DesignAgile Methodologies

2.2K+

Cover Letters & Follow-ups

1.8K+

Resumes Tailored

190.5K+

Jobs Tracked

Trusted by professionals at

PwC//
Emaar//
KPMG//
Noon//
Amazon AWS//
Talabat//
Deloitte//
Emirates//
Careem//
Aramex//
McKinsey//
Property Finder//
Majid Al Futtaim//
Chalhoub Group//
PwC//
Emaar//
KPMG//
Noon//
Amazon AWS//
Talabat//
Deloitte//
Emirates//
Careem//
Aramex//
McKinsey//
Property Finder//
Majid Al Futtaim//
Chalhoub Group//
AI Job Platform

Stop applying blindly. Start getting hired.

Base Career automates the hardest parts of job searching — apply smarter, not harder.

AI Resume in 60s

Your resume rewritten for this exact role using the job description as the brief.

ATS-Optimized

Get past automated screening filters with the right keywords matched to each job.

Application Tracker

Track every job, follow-up, and interview in one visual kanban board.

Free plan · No credit card required